Despite ample oxygen, small amounts of carbon monoxide (CO) are still formed, an environmental pollutant regulated by the Federal Immission Control Act. Although having excess oxygen helps reduce CO, it doesn\u2019t necessarily enhance efficiency. Heating unnecessary air is inefficient, and since oxygen and nitrogen have lower emissivity than combustion products, efficiency is further decreased.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image size-full\"><img decoding=\"async\" width=\"300\" height=\"141\" src=\"https:\/\/www.yokogawa.com\/eu\/blog\/app\/uploads\/sites\/8\/2025\/02\/TDLS-combustion-1-300x141-1.png\" alt=\"\" class=\"wp-image-12266\"\/><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<p>Incomplete combustion can lead to coking or damage from CO afterburning in heat exchangers.
